Output 66dbb42923c88550ca0656d50547f4565b19cf2aca85ccf8175dbf45adf03104:0

value
140708306
script pubkey
OP_0 OP_PUSHBYTES_20 75178325e605914ef579de9d58289b3e258d5b7a
address
ltc1qw5tcxf0xqkg5aatem6w4s2ym8cjc6km6nck7xj
transaction
66dbb42923c88550ca0656d50547f4565b19cf2aca85ccf8175dbf45adf03104
spent
true